XRP suffered a sharp rejection at the $1.600 resistance area, a level that has capped prices since January 2026. This zone coincides with the daily Bollinger Band upper rail and the 38.2% Fibonacci retracement of the downtrend that began in early January, creating a triple-layer technical barrier.

Triple Resistance at $1.600

The $1.600 level also aligns with the Fibonacci correction point and the upper Bollinger Band limit. After touching this area, XRP quickly reversed, ending a short-lived rebound. Technical analysts noted a similar resistance structure in mid-February, when an Evening Star pattern triggered a roughly 18% decline.

Long-Legged Doji Confirms Reversal

The latest reversal produced a Long-Legged Doji on the daily candlestick chart. This pattern indicates intense tug-of-war between bulls and bears near a critical level, with the bears ultimately winning. Combined with the earlier Evening Star, consecutive reversal signals strengthen the bearish bias.

Next Target: $1.3395 Support

Given the persistent downtrend since January and the limited bounce, analysts expect XRP to continue lower toward the $1.3395 support. This level has repeatedly stemmed declines in late February and early March (sub-waves a, ii, iii). A break below would open the door to further losses.
